徐州市网站建设_网站建设公司_悬停效果_seo优化
2026/1/22 16:35:25 网站建设 项目流程

1. 为什么这个毕设项目值得你 pick ?

告别“烂大街”选题!本系统设计了一套基于Java的岗位变动智慧管理系统,涵盖了会员管理、考勤记录、绩效考核等模块。相比传统选题,它具有更高的创新性和实用性:首先,在功能上实现了数据录入自动化与信息更新智能化;其次,通过细化每个角色的操作权限和流程审核机制提升了系统的灵活性和安全性;最后,引入了数据可视化组件ECharts.js进行结果呈现,使得管理者能够更直观地理解业务状况。零基础开发者也能轻松掌握该系统的设计思路:各模块功能明确、开发难度适中,并提供了详细的源代码与论文支持,帮助初学者快速上手并构建自己的智慧管理系统。

2. 开发背景分析

开发岗位变动智慧管理系统在企业人力资源管理中具有重要意义。当前,多数企业在进行员工管理时依赖传统纸质记录或简单的电子表格系统,这不仅效率低下、容易出错,还难以实现数据的实时更新和统计分析。通过引入基于Java的岗位变动智慧管理系统,可以有效提升企业的管理水平。 该系统的开发背景在于:随着信息技术的发展及企业规模的增长,人力资源部门面临的工作压力日益增大。传统的管理模式已无法满足现代化企业管理的需求。因此,有必要构建一个集会员管理、考勤记录、绩效考核等于一体的智能化系统,以提高工作效率和数据准确性。 岗位变动智慧管理系统能够实时跟踪员工的职业发展动态,自动审核并处理职位调整申请,并提供详细的统计分析报告。同时,该系统还支持通知公告管理和教育培训管理等功能模块,有助于提升企业培训效果及员工满意度。此外,绩效考核与薪资福利的关联性使得管理者可以更加精准地评估员工表现和合理分配资源。 通过开发这样一个全面且高效的智慧管理系统,不仅能够显著减轻人力资源部门的工作负担,还能为决策者提供有力的数据支持,从而促进企业的持续健康发展。

3. 系统需求分析

岗位变动智慧管理系统的主要功能包括:系统会员管理、岗位管理、岗位变动申请管理、通知公告管理、会员阅读记录管理、考勤记录管理、绩效考核管理、绩效指标管理、绩效结果管理、培训课程管理、培训报名管理、薪资管理、福利管理、考核问卷管理、问卷问题管理、问卷答案管理。

3.1 系统会员管理功能分析

系统会员管理功能定义:数据录入方面,支持创建、修改和删除会员信息;数据查询方面,提供按条件检索的接口;信息变更方面,允许更新会员状态等基本信息;数据审核方面,部门领导可对异常或敏感字段进行确认与修正;统计分析方面,生成各类报表如会员活跃度报告。

3.2 岗位管理功能分析

岗位管理主要字段属性包括:岗位编码、岗位名称、所属部门、描述及状态。录入时需验证输入合法性与唯一性,确保数据准确无误;查询功能支持按关键字模糊搜索或精确匹配检索所需信息,便于快速定位特定记录;变更操作允许修改岗位相关信息,并对变动进行版本追踪以保留历史记录;审核环节由上级领导执行,负责确认调整合理性并批准生效;统计分析模块则汇总各项指标形成报表,展示部门及整体的岗位配置情况与趋势变化。

3.3 岗位变动申请管理功能分析

岗位变动申请管理主要字段包括:岗位变动申请编码、所属申请人、当前部门与岗位、目标部门与岗位、变动原因及类型等。数据录入时,普通员工需填写相关信息提交;数据查询支持多种条件筛选和排序,并可导出Excel文件保存记录。信息变更主要用于修改已提但未审核的申请详情或状态更新。系统提供权限控制确保只有部门领导能进行数据审核与处理时间、结果及意见等操作。统计分析方面,系统可通过图表展示岗位变动频率趋势以及各类变动原因占比情况,帮助管理层优化人力资源配置策略。

3.4 通知公告管理功能分析

通知公告管理功能定义:录入方面,支持添加、编辑和删除通知公告;查询方面,提供按标题或内容模糊搜索及按发布时间筛选的功能;变更方面,允许修改已发布的通知状态(如置顶与否);审核方面,部门领导可进行发布前的审批与退回处理;统计分析方面,系统生成的通知阅读次数、发布频次等数据报表供管理决策参考。

3.5 (略)(查看更多请关注博主获取)

4. 系统设计

4.1 系统架构设计

三层架构设计包括UI表示层、业务逻辑层和数据访问层。UI表示层负责展示界面与用户交互,使用HTML5+CSS3进行页面布局,并结合JavaScript实现动态效果;优势在于分离了视图和技术细节,便于维护更新。业务逻辑层处理核心算法及流程控制,采用SpringMVC框架开发Controller、Service接口,封装业务操作和数据校验,提升代码复用性和扩展性。数据访问层利用JDBC或MyBatis进行数据库交互,实现CRUD等基本功能,并通过事务管理确保数据一致性;该架构分层清晰,职责划分明确,增强了系统的可维护性和模块化程度,便于团队协作开发与后期升级优化。

4.2 功能模块设计

岗位变动智慧管理系统旨在提升企业人力资源管理效率,其功能模块包括:系统会员管理、岗位管理、岗位变动申请管理、通知公告管理、会员阅读记录管理、考勤记录管理、绩效考核管理、绩效指标管理、绩效结果管理、培训课程管理、培训报名管理、薪资管理、福利管理、考核问卷管理、问卷问题管理和问卷答案管理。系统主要角色为普通员工和部门领导,前者负责数据录入与查阅执行等操作,后者则进行审核及数据分析工作。各模块字段属性详尽描述已给出,如会员管理包括系统会员编码、密码等;岗位变动申请管理涉及变动原因、类型以及处理结果等内容。该系统采用SpringMVC开发框架配合MySQL数据库构建,全面覆盖企业人力资源管理系统所需功能点。

4.2.1 系统会员管理模块

系统会员管理中参与的角色用例包括:普通员工和部门领导。普通员工角色负责录入、查阅更新会员信息;部门领导数据审核及确认,具体模块描述如下:1)会员注册/注销-普通员工创建新用户或删除现有账户;2)个人信息修改-普通员工编辑个人资料;3)密码重置-普通员工请求并执行更改密码流程;4)状态变更审批-部门领导审查并批准成员状态变动(如激活、冻结)。

系统会员管理主要属性包括:系统会员编码、会员名、密码、真实姓名、身份证号、手机号、邮箱、头像、状态。

4.2.2 岗位管理模块

岗位管理模块涉及的角色用例包括:部门领导和普通员工。角色职责为:1) 部门领导负责岗位的添加、修改与删除操作;2) 普通员工仅能查看岗位信息,无法进行任何变更操作。系统提供权限控制机制确保数据安全性和准确性。

岗位管理主要属性包括:岗位编码、岗位名称、所属部门、岗位编码、岗位描述、状态。

4.2.3 岗位变动申请管理模块

岗位变动申请管理中参与角色包括普通员工和部门领导。普通员工负责提交岗位变动申请,填写基本信息如所属申请人、当前职位信息等,并选择目标职位及原因;系统自动记录申请时间与编码。随后该申请进入审核流程,由部门领导进行审批:评估合理性(通过与否)、确定处理意见并更新状态至“已审”。在此过程中,普通员工可查询未完成的变动请求及其进度。最终,若申请获准,则进行相应职位调整,并通知相关人员;反之则保持原状或进一步沟通修改方案后再提交。

岗位变动申请管理主要属性包括:岗位变动申请编码、所属申请人、所属当前部门、所属当前岗位、所属目标部门、所属目标岗位、变动原因、变动类型、申请状态、申请时间、处理时间、所属处理人、处理结果、处理意见。

4.2.4 通知公告管理模块

通知公告管理中涉及发布人和阅读者角色。发布人创建通知,填写编码、标题、内容等字段,并选择状态(如是否置顶)、开始与结束时间。系统验证信息后保存记录并标记发布时间及所属部门/岗位。阅读者的会员需登录查看列表,点击特定的通知可查看详情包括公告编码、标题和内容;系统更新该通知的阅读次数。阅读者还可将已读或未读状态反馈给发布人以辅助后续管理与优化。

通知公告管理主要属性包括:通知公告编码、通知标题、通知内容、所属发布人、发布时间、状态、开始时间、结束时间、是否置顶、阅读次数。

4.2.5 (略)(查看更多请关注博主获取)

5. 系统实现

5.1 核心功能实现

5.1.1 系统登录

打开系统登录网址,输入账号、密码、验证码确定登录即可,登录界面如图所示。

5.1.2 系统会员管理功能实现

系统会员管理功能包括系统会员列表、系统会员统计。

在系统会员列表中可以选择新增系统会员、编辑系统会员、删除系统会员、搜索系统会员等。系统会员属性包括:系统会员编码、会员名、密码、真实姓名、身份证号、手机号、邮箱、头像、状态等。新增系统会员界面如图所示:

在系统会员统计中可以看到状态统计,状态统计如图所示:

5.1.3 岗位管理功能实现

岗位管理功能包括岗位列表、岗位统计。

在岗位列表中可以选择新增岗位、编辑岗位、删除岗位、搜索岗位等。岗位属性包括:岗位编码、岗位名称、所属部门、岗位编码、岗位描述、状态等。新增岗位界面如图所示:

在岗位统计中可以看到状态统计,状态统计如图所示:

5.1.4 岗位变动申请管理功能实现

岗位变动申请管理功能包括岗位变动申请列表、岗位变动申请统计。

在岗位变动申请列表中可以选择新增岗位变动申请、编辑岗位变动申请、删除岗位变动申请、搜索岗位变动申请等。岗位变动申请属性包括:岗位变动申请编码、所属申请人、所属当前部门、所属当前岗位、所属目标部门、所属目标岗位、变动原因、变动类型、申请状态、申请时间、处理时间、所属处理人、处理结果、处理意见等。新增岗位变动申请界面如图所示:

在岗位变动申请统计中可以看到变动类型统计、申请状态统计、申请时间年统计、申请时间月统计、申请时间日统计、处理时间年统计、处理时间月统计、处理时间日统计、处理结果统计,申请状态统计如图所示:

5.1.5 通知公告管理功能实现

通知公告管理功能包括通知公告列表、通知公告统计。

在通知公告列表中可以选择新增通知公告、编辑通知公告、删除通知公告、搜索通知公告等。通知公告属性包括:通知公告编码、通知标题、通知内容、所属发布人、发布时间、状态、开始时间、结束时间、是否置顶、阅读次数等。新增通知公告界面如图所示:

在通知公告统计中可以看到发布时间年统计、发布时间月统计、发布时间日统计、状态统计、开始时间年统计、开始时间月统计、开始时间日统计、结束时间年统计、结束时间月统计、结束时间日统计、是否置顶统计,状态统计如图所示:

5.1.6 (略)(查看更多请关注博主获取)

6. 福利来了!这些资源帮你省时间

需要项目源码和毕设论文的可以关注评论哈,同时也欢迎在评论区留言交流项目开发过程中遇到的问题,分享自己的开发经验。如果觉得本文对你有帮助,欢迎点赞、收藏、转发。

资源获取地址:[https://bishe.it87.cn/web/main/search.html?keyword=岗位变动智慧管理系统]

操作手册

毕设论文

答辩PPT

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询